The Keys: Papa LEGBA (Elegua: -lgbra)

Keys have represented various spiritual symbologies for as long as man has had locks. 

They connect to gateways and portals, doorways to the unknown, knowledge, mysteries, powers, initiations, new ways, forbidden things, and answers to curious questions. 

They are often associated with various literary idioms, specific deities, or spiritual figures and are often used as part of charms or other magical tools.

Keys also represent spiritual purity and enlightenment in these scenes.

In Vodou practices, Papa Legba, often depicted as an older man with a cane, a dog, and keys, is also a gatekeeper.

Believed to have originated in the kingdom of Dahomey, now Benin, Papa Legba is one of the best-known figures in African spirituality.

He is one of the spirits associated with the crossroads; he serves as an intermediary between man and the spirit world. Because of his gift of elocution, he is a being with substantial influence over communication and speech.

Which now makes the statement “communication is key” ludicrous to me.

He is a master communicator who is said to speak the languages of all human beings; he then translates #petitions and delivers them to the other Lwa (spirits)

He is a great teacher and #warrior but also a #trickster deity. Legba is a remover of obstacles and is consulted to help find new, positive opportunities, in a sense he will provide you with a key, thanks to his ability to open doors and new roads.

The symbol is deeply embedded into our psyche.  We even honor people by giving them the “Key to the City,” representing trust and respect. 

The key’s many-layered symbology is seemingly endless in its connections to humanity throughout the ages

Is there anything that differentiates demons from celestial beings (like gods)? We see pif as a celestial being in the intro of the 4th season of LMK, but she’s now considered a demon

The simple answer is a position in heaven. Think about Monkey in the beginning of his arc. He's a rebellious demon who is offered a job in heaven to keep his shenanigans in check. Then he's a literal god of horses.

The scholar Robert Campany has a great article where he explains how demons and gods move up and down within the cosmic hierarchy. You can read it here.
